WebMar 22, 2024 · Side sleepers generally require thicker pillows than back and stomach sleepers, in order to keep the head aligned with the rest of the spine. For side sleepers, a medium to medium firm mattress can help support heavier parts of the body without causing pressure buildup at the hips and shoulders. WebMar 10, 2024 · The three most common CPAP mask designs are full-face, nasal, and nasal pillow masks. Full-face masks are the bulkiest, as they cover both the nose and the mouth, while nasal masks cover only the nose. Nasal pillow masks are the least obtrusive, as they cover only the nostrils and do not have a hard shell.
